2024 ERC Championship: 8 rallies with the return of a round in England?

There is nothing official yet and permutations are likely to occur depending on the signing of the different agreements, but the program of theERC 2024 is taking shape. There is clearly no desire to change the plan put in place this year. There should therefore be 8 meetings with a fair distribution of 4 on dirt and 4 on asphalt.

The first significant change should be the disappearance of the Rally Serras de Fafe in Portugal which opened the championship for the last three years. The order in which the races will take place is not yet clear, so it is not possible to say which of the Canaries, Poland (if the event is not promoted in WRC !) or Royal Scandinavia will be on pole in 7 or 8 months. In addition to these three rounds similar to 2023, Roma Capitale, Barum and Hungary will also be on the list.

To replace Portugal, there is obviously a desire to visit Ceredigion which is based in Aberystwyth (bless you…) in Wales (180 km north of Cardiff). This season, this rally which takes place on asphalt is integrated into the TER (September 2-3). Will it stay on the same surface? Will he have to find specials on land? Before being certain of appearing in the ERC, there remain questions of budget, because it seems that the English federation (led by David Richards) does not intend to put a Pound Sterling into this project. If this accession takes place, the organizers must not fantasize about a possible arrival in the WRC. They have already been notified that this will not happen.

The other modification will concern Liepaja which takes the elevator towards the elite while Estonia should take the opposite path. Discussions are still ongoing. This is also the case for a meeting in France. For two years, there has been a desire among the promoter to come to France, but this will not happen in 2024. The validation of all these rumors and the concretization of the calendar will have to wait for the coming weeks. An E-vote is planned before the end of August for the WRC. Will the ERC be integrated into the same process?
